More yen for N.Z.
PA Wellington The Government has announced that it will take up a third yen bond issue on the Japanese market later this year. The Prime Minister (Mr Muldoon) said that the issue would take advantage of the “favourable borrowing terms which were expected to exist about that time.” His statement, did not give any further details, other than say that the terms of the loan would be fixed closer to the date of issue.
